The Palais Garnier, the opera house Charles Garnier completed in 1875, is among the most opulent theatres in the world. The grand staircase, the gilded Grand Foyer, and the auditorium with its ceiling painted by Marc Chagall are open to visitors. A small library-museum traces the history of the Paris Opera.
